Eric Taylor (born December 14, 1981 in Winchester, Tennessee) is a Canadian football defensive tackle for the BC Lions of the Canadian Football League. He was drafted by the Pittsburgh Steelers in the seventh round of the 2004 NFL Draft. He played college football at Memphis.

In the NFL, Taylor has played for the Minnesota Vikings, Seattle Seahawks and Tennessee Titans.

Taylor played his first two seasons in the CFL for the Edmonton Eskimos. On February 10, 2010, Taylor was traded to the Toronto Argonauts from the Eskimos in exchange for receivers Andre Talbot and Brad Smith. He signed with the BC Lions through free agency on February 16, 2011.[1]
